Can you put McDonald's fries in the microwave?

How to reheat Mcdonald french fries in the microwave: Spread your fries out on a microwave-safe plate so they're in a single layer. Microwave the fries on high for 20-30 seconds. Let the fries rest for a few seconds before serving.

How do you reheat a McDonald's Big Mac?

To reheat a Big Mac in the oven, preheat it to 350°F (180°C). Remove any lettuce and outer buns. Sprinkle 1 tablespoon of water over the top of the Big Mac and wrap it in foil. Reheat for 8-10 minutes, turning once.

Can I microwave a McChicken?

The best way to reheat a McChicken sandwich is to remove the lettuce and mayo, then fry the patty in a pan and heat the bun in a microwave. Lightly oil a pan and fry the patty for 1-2 minutes on each side. Cover the bun with a damp paper towel and microwave it for 30 seconds.

Can you reheat McNuggets?

The best way to reheat McNuggets is in the oven. Place the nuggets on a wire rack and cook at 350°F (180°C) for 8-10 minutes. For best results, lightly spray the nuggets with oil. Avoid placing the nuggets directly on a baking tray as this causes the bottom of the nuggets to go soggy.

How do you reheat a McMuffin?

Place your McMuffin on a microwave-safe plate. Lightly cover the muffin with a piece of damp paper towel. Microwave your muffin in 30-second intervals until it's warmed through. Then, remove it from the microwave, remove the paper towel, and allow it to rest for a further 30 seconds.
